WARREN, Mich. –
Elcometer, an inspection equipment design, manufacturing and supply company for the automotive and protective coatings markets, has moved into its new North American headquarters and training facility.
Based in Warren, Mich., Elcometer’s new 22,000-square-foot North American headquarters at 6900 Miller Drive provides office space for sales and technical support teams and accommodates its ISO 17025 test laboratory, providing fully accredited servicing and training support to automotive coatings, body shop, and remarketing inspection markets in the United States and Canada.
“North America is a very important market for Elcometer, and the move to larger premises means we can accommodate demand for our U.S. and Canadian customers well into the future,” Michael Sellars, managing director at Elcometer, said in a news release.
“Our new facility also allows us to expand into new product ranges, which, following the introduction in Europe and the Middle East in November, will be launched in North America in the spring,” said Joe Walker, vice president of Elcometer.
